Gettin it done.

Well everybody. I decided to keep the Grand Prix and finish it out. I just put the Tv's and DVD player back in. Took all the plastic out of the car the other day and me and my girl are covering it with dark Green material. It looks really good so far. I've been workin on suspention to fit some 20 inch wires. Workin on gettin a new Clothe top put on. Hopefully Dennis can hook a brotha up with some flake and I'll be cruising soon. The caddy is still in the working, i got some Vogue Tyres coming for the 17" rims and the tv's are getting put in the headrest in a couple of weeks. Tint should be done with in a couple of weeks too. Well thought i would post an update. The Grand Prix will be rolling strong this year. If you want to see the before pics, its in the classifieds page. 1998 Grand Prix For Sale. Hope to see alot of you out this year. Later.
